The Van Kessel Group of Milheeze has placed an order for five hydrogen trailers. Hexagon Purus, a Norwegian company specializing in hydrogen systems, is building the trailers.

The trailers will be used to supply Van Kessel’s Greenpoint hydrogen filling stations.

The trucks are outfitted with 20-foot containers supplied with special Type 4 lightweight composite cylinders capable of storing hydrogen at a pressure of 300 bar. Each trailer is capable of transporting 400 kg of hydrogen. Wystrach GmbH, a subsidiary of Hexagon Purus, supplies the trailers. Wystrach specializes in hydrogen storage and distribution systems. Deliveries are anticipated to begin in Q3 2022 and conclude in Q1 2023.

The trailers will be used by Van Kessel to supply hydrogen to filling points. Van Kessel is the operator of Nieuwegein’s Greenpoint Hysolar hydrogen refueling station. New hydrogen station projects in Oude-Tonge, Ede, and Dordrecht, among others, are nearing completion.
